INCREASED STAKE IN PHOSPHATE RESOURCES
CI Resources Limited (ASX: CII) is pleased to announce that it has increased its stake in Phosphate Resources Limited (PRL) to 41.74%. CI Resources remains PRL’s largest shareholder.
The stake represents an increase of 2.97% to CI Resources holding in PRL since December 08. Under the creep provisions of the Corporations Act, CI Resources can acquire up to 3% of PRL in a six month period.
PRL is an unlisted public company which carries out phosphate mining on Christmas Island, where it has mined and exported phosphate since 1990. PRL is the biggest employer on Christmas Island.
CI Resources Chairman, Mr Clive Brown, said CI Resources would continue to examine ways to maximise shareholder value, including the potential to further increase the Company’s exposure to PRL as is considered appropriate by the Board and in accordance with the Corporations Act.
“Despite the current weak market conditions, the medium to long term outlook for phosphate and wider fertiliser demand remains excellent. An increased holding in PRL will stand CI Resources in good stead to benefit from this outlook,” continued Mr Brown.
